Abstract

The invention belongs to the field of biological medicines, and particularly relates to a probiotic composition with a menstruation regulating function and application thereof, which are suitable for dysmenorrhea in menstrual periods of women, particularly suitable for primary dysmenorrhea of young women. A probiotic composition with menstruation regulating effect comprises Lactobacillus rhamnosus, Lactobacillus plantarum and Bifidobacterium longum. The probiotic composition can also be compounded with medicinal and edible traditional Chinese medicines with menstruation regulating function, and has synergistic effect. The probiotics is an internationally recognized probiotic substance and has the advantages of safe source, obvious effect, no toxic or side effect and the like. The probiotic composition disclosed by the invention not only can be safely eaten, but also has a menstruation regulating function, particularly can be used for inhibiting primary dysmenorrhea, and provides a new application of probiotics. The probiotics and the medicine-food homologous traditional Chinese medicine are compounded to exert the advantages together, thereby achieving the effect of safely and effectively treating the dysmenorrhea.

Background
Dysmenorrhea is a common clinical gynecological disease, and refers to the symptoms of lower abdomen or waist pain, even lumbosacral pain during and before menstrual period; each time it occurs with the menstrual cycle, severe cases may be accompanied by nausea, vomiting, cold sweat, cold hands and feet, and even syncope. According to related investigation, the incidence rate of dysmenorrhea is 33.19%, the mild degree is 45.73%, the moderate degree is 38.81%, and the severe degree is 13.55%. The primary dysmenorrhea of young women reaches 75%, which brings serious influence to the life, social contact and health of women, and long-term dysmenorrhea can also cause infertility, induce various gynecological diseases, and simultaneously affect the development of infants in uterus.
At present, western medicines such as analgesics, hormone medicines and traditional Chinese medicines are commonly used in the market for treating dysmenorrhea, and the traditional Chinese medicines can be classified into two types: one is an oral conditioning type Chinese patent medicine product, such as rhizoma corydalis pain relieving capsule, ease pill, decoction of four ingredients, ai Fu warming uterus pill, etc., and the other is an external conditioning and health care type product, such as dysmenorrhea patch, motherwort warming uterus patch, etc. Chinese traditional medicine for treating dysmenorrhea such as CN200610002243.4 and CN 103585403A, CN 103656463A are prepared from common Chinese herbal medicines with effects of benefiting qi and nourishing blood, promoting blood circulation for removing blood stasis, warming channels for dispelling cold and relieving pain. The long-term taking of the medicine can cause psychological stress of patients and also can cause side effects of the medicine. It is therefore desirable to provide an edible product suitable for dysmenorrhea in women.
Probiotics is a kind of active microorganisms beneficial to a host, and is a general term for active beneficial microorganisms which are planted in the intestinal tract and the reproductive system of a human body and can generate definite health efficacy so as to improve the micro-ecological balance of the host and play beneficial roles. It is an internationally recognized safe food additive, has been widely applied to dairy products, health products and pharmaceutical industries, and is mainly used for regulating intestinal functions, reducing blood cholesterol level, preventing harmful substances from generating, delaying human body aging, regulating human body immunity, inhibiting lactose intolerance, resisting tumors and the like, such as Chinese patents CN101772308A, CN102511707A, CN101864375A, CN103653170A and the like. However, no report about the effect of probiotics on treating dysmenorrhea is available at present.

Example 2 product having menstruation regulating function
The preparation method comprises the following steps:
(1) preparing active probiotic dry powder:
1) respectively activating Lactobacillus rhamnosus, Lactobacillus plantarum and Bifidobacterium longum with culture medium, inoculating into fermentation culture medium, shake culturing to make thallus concentration reach logarithmic growth phase of 0.5-2 × 109CFU/mL。
Preparation of bifidobacterium seed liquid: taking out the strain storage tube, scratching a plate with a bifidobacterium solid culture medium for resuscitation, and carrying out anaerobic culture at 37 ℃ for 48-72 hours. A single colony was picked up under the plate and inoculated into 50 ml of a culture medium for Bifidobacterium, and cultured in an anaerobic incubator for 48 hours. Inoculating 5% of the seed into a 3L large triangular flask (the liquid loading amount is 2.5L), sealing with sterile vegetable oil, performing anaerobic culture at 37 deg.C for 36-48 hr, and detecting the bacterial liquid concentration, wherein the bacterial content is 5 hundred million/ml, and the liquid fermentation can be terminated. Wherein the culture medium of bifidobacterium is as follows: casein peptone 1%, soybean peptone 0.5%, ferment0.25% of mother powder, 1.5% of glucose and K2HPO4 0.2%,MgCl2·6H2O 0.05%,CaCl2 0.015%,ZnSO4·7H2O 0.025%,FeCl30.01 percent, 0.005 percent of L-cysteine hydrochloride and 1mL of tween-801 (1000mL plus 1mL), adjusting the pH value to 6.5, adding 1.5 percent agar powder into a solid culture medium, and sterilizing for 15min under 0.1 MPa.
Preparation of lactobacillus seed liquid: taking out the strain preservation tube, scratching a flat plate by using an MRS solid culture medium for resuscitation, and carrying out anaerobic culture at 37 ℃ for 48 hours. Individual colonies were picked under the plate and inoculated into 100ml of MRS medium and anaerobically cultured in an incubator at 37 ℃ for 24 hours. Inoculating 5% of the seed into a 3L large triangular flask (the liquid loading amount is 2.5L), carrying out anaerobic culture at 37 ℃ for 24-48 hours, detecting the concentration of the bacterial liquid, and stopping the fermentation of the lactobacillus liquid when the bacterial content exceeds 10 hundred million/ml. Wherein, the MRS culture medium: 2.0% of glucose, 0.2% of ammonium citrate, 0.5% of sodium acetate, 0.5% of dipotassium phosphate, 0.02% of manganese sulfate, 0.05% of magnesium sulfate, 1.0% of peptone, 1.0% of beef extract, 0.5% of yeast extract, 800.1% of tween-E and 6.0% of PH; adding 1.5% agar powder into solid culture medium, and sterilizing at 0.1MPa for 15 min.
2) And mixing the fermentation liquids of all strains, centrifuging, discarding the supernatant, washing the thallus precipitate, centrifuging, and discarding the supernatant to obtain the bacterial sludge.
3) Preparing a bacterial powder protective agent, wherein the formula comprises 8g of sucrose, 26g of skimmed milk powder, 1mL of glycerol, 100mL of distilled water and 115 ℃, and sterilizing for 15 min.
4) And (3) fully mixing the bacterial powder protective agent and the bacterial mud, pre-freezing the mixture, and then carrying out vacuum freeze drying to obtain the active probiotic dry powder.
(2) Sieving
And (2) sieving the active probiotic dry powder obtained in the step (1) by a sieve of 80-100 meshes.
(3) Counting bacterial powder: and measuring the viable count of the probiotic dry powder by using a flat plate colony counting method.
(4) Preparing materials: weighing the screened probiotic dry powder, and mixing according to the viable count proportion of the lactobacillus rhamnosus, the lactobacillus plantarum and the bifidobacterium longum in the formula 1-4; the auxiliary material is skimmed milk powder.
(5) Mixing: and (3) fully and uniformly mixing the prepared probiotic compositions and auxiliary materials until the colors are uniform and consistent and no color difference exists, and obtaining products 1, 2, 3 and 4 with the function of regulating menstruation.
Example 3 test verification of product with menstruation regulating function
1. Animal experiments
Construction, grouping and administration of a mouse primary dysmenorrhea model: 80 female Kunming white mice of 18-22g are selected and randomly divided into 8 treatment groups, namely a blank control group, a model group, a positive group (commercially available Yueyueshutongjingbao granules), a product 1, a product 2, a product 3 and a product 4, wherein each group comprises 10 mice. Except the blank group, the other groups jointly replicate the primary dysmenorrheal model by estrogen and oxytocin, and the specific operation is as follows: at a dose of 10 mg/kg-1·d-1The uterus of the mice is synchronized by injecting estradiol benzoate into the abdominal cavity continuously for 10 days, equivalent distilled water is fed into a normal group and a model group from the 4 th day, equivalent drugs (the human body dosage is 20g/d, the daily administration dosage of the mice is converted according to the body surface area; the administration volume is 0.5 mL/mouse) are fed into other groups, the drugs are continuously fed for 7 days, after the administration for 1 hour on the 7 th day, 0.05 mL/mouse is injected into the abdominal cavity, the times of writhing of the mice in each group within 30min after the abdominal cavity injection of oxytocin are recorded, and the writhing reaction inhibition rate and the writhing incidence rate are calculated according to the following formulas. The inventors analyzed the results of treating primary dysmenorrhea in mice, and see table 1.
The torsion incidence rate is equal to the total number of torsion generating animals in each group/experimental animals in each group multiplied by 100 percent
The twisting inhibition rate is [ (twisting reaction times of model group-twisting reaction times of administration group) ÷ twisting reaction times of model group ] × 100%
Table 1 therapeutic effect of probiotic composition provided by the present invention on primary dysmenorrhea of mice
Note: SPSS 16.0 is adopted to count the times of twisting, One-way ANOVA is adopted to carry out One-way variance analysis, a Duncan method is adopted to carry out multiple comparison, the result is expressed by mean value plus or minus standard deviation, and the same column in the table is marked with different lower case letters to express that the difference between groups is obvious (P < 0.05); the same lower case letters are used to indicate that the differences between groups are not significant.
2. Human body trial
In order to verify the effect of the product in the invention on treating dysmenorrhea, the inventor carries out clinical observation on 20 cases of dysmenorrhea patients, takes product 2 as an example, 10g of the product is taken each time, 2 times a day, 7 days are taken continuously in the first 5 days, and after 1 treatment course, 3 cases are cured (main symptoms disappear, no obvious discomfort exists before and after menstrual period), accounting for 15 percent; effective (the main symptoms are obviously relieved, and the discomfort before and after the menstrual period is slight) 12 cases, accounting for 60 percent; the total effective rate is 75%.

Example 4 medicinal and edible Chinese medicinal formula with menstruation regulating function
The formula A is as follows: 50g of honey-fried licorice root, 60g of medlar, 60g of red date, 30g of dried orange peel, 30g of dried ginger and 90g of longan.
And the formula B is as follows: prepared licorice root 100g, matrimony vine 120g, red jujube 200g, dried orange peel 100g, dried ginger 100g, longan 150 g.
And a formula C: 80g of honey-fried licorice root, 60g of medlar, 200g of red date, 100g of dried orange peel, 30g of dried ginger and 100g of longan.
And (3) formula D: 60g of honey-fried licorice root, 100g of medlar, 150g of red date, 60g of dried orange peel, 30g of dried ginger and 120g of longan.
And a formula E: 60g of honey-fried licorice root, 120g of medlar, 100g of red date, 60g of dried orange peel, 60g of dried ginger and 120g of longan.
Respectively taking medicinal and edible traditional Chinese medicines according to the formula, adding water (mass-volume ratio) which is 8 times of the total weight of the medicines, soaking for 2h, boiling with strong fire, decocting with slow fire for 30min, filtering, and keeping filtrate I; adding 6 times of water into the residue, boiling with strong fire, decocting with slow fire for 20min, filtering, and retaining filtrate II; mixing the first and second filtrates, vacuum concentrating under reduced pressure, and vacuum freeze drying to obtain Chinese medicinal extract product A, product B, product C, product D, and product E.
